Mobbill, O. J.

—The questions at issue in this case are identical with those in the case of Jones v. McMahan, decided at the present term of the court during the Galveston session. [30 Tex., 719.]

Bor the reasons stated in said cause, it is ordered that the judgment be reversed, and it is further ordered that the clerk of the district court be ordered to issue the execution as requested.

Bevebsed and obdebed acooedingly.
